The Charge of the Light Brigade is a poem written by Alfred, Lord Tennyson. The poem tells a story of a battle where six hundred lightly equipped British men charged into a valley during the Crimean war. They were very outnumbered by Russian forces who were on either sides and in front of them. The poem highlights not only the nobility and bravery of the soldiers, but also the ugliness of war. Tennyson wrote this poem to honour those British soldiers who did only but obey. He uses lots of literary devices like alliteration, repetition, metonymy etc. He also uses things like the rhyme scheme to add to the meaning of the poem.
